Market Overview
Thermal spray is a coating process in which melted or heated materials are sprayed onto a surface to create a protective or functional layer. These coatings enhance properties such as:
Wear resistance
Corrosion protection
Thermal insulation
Electrical conductivity
Thermal spray technologies are widely used in sectors such as aerospace, automotive, energy, healthcare, and industrial manufacturing.
Key Market Drivers
1. Rising Demand in Aerospace and Aviation
The aerospace industry is a major driver of thermal spray adoption. Coatings are used to improve the performance and longevity of aircraft components, including:
Turbine blades
Engine parts
Landing gear systems
Thermal spray coatings help withstand extreme temperatures and harsh operating environments, making them essential in aviation applications.
2. Growth in Automotive and Transportation
In the automotive sector, thermal spray is increasingly used to enhance engine efficiency and reduce emissions. Applications include:
Cylinder coatings
Brake components
Transmission systems
With the growing focus on fuel efficiency and lightweight vehicles, demand for advanced coating technologies is rising.
3. Expansion of Energy and Power Generation
The energy sector, including oil & gas and power generation, relies heavily on thermal spray coatings to protect equipment from corrosion and wear. These coatings are used in:
Boilers and turbines
Pipelines and valves
Offshore structures
As global energy demand increases, the need for durable and efficient equipment continues to drive market growth.
4. Increasing Focus on Equipment Longevity
Industries are increasingly investing in maintenance and lifecycle extension strategies. Thermal spray coatings offer a cost-effective solution by:
Reducing downtime
Extending component lifespan
Improving operational efficiency
This trend is particularly important for industries with high capital equipment costs.
Market Segmentation Insights
By Process
Plasma spray
High-velocity oxy-fuel (HVOF)
Flame spray
Electric arc spray
Cold spray
Plasma spray and HVOF processes dominate due to their superior coating quality and performance characteristics.
By Material
Metals
Ceramics
Polymers
Composites
Ceramic coatings are widely used for thermal barrier applications, especially in aerospace and energy sectors.

Challenges Facing the Market
1. High Equipment and Operational Costs
Thermal spray systems require significant investment, which can be a barrier for small and medium-sized enterprises.
2. Skilled Labor Requirements
The process requires trained professionals to ensure quality and consistency, creating challenges in workforce availability.
3. Competition from Alternative Technologies
Other surface coating technologies, such as physical vapor deposition (PVD) and chemical vapor deposition (CVD), present competitive alternatives.
